Output 8c623cda7f1821cec470211d932444b02523eb71d8f8e6ac7f456f20032e01bf:0

value
2096740
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9586a1d9099b2dcf813aae8e5fdfef9b35ef2d6 OP_EQUAL
address
3QRS6TVj46SpZ8AqGWktdhHPTbXmnRXXdU
transaction
8c623cda7f1821cec470211d932444b02523eb71d8f8e6ac7f456f20032e01bf
confirmations
341839
spent
true